Summary:

The 66012 zip code is home to a single public high school, Bonner Springs High School, which serves grades 9-12 with an enrollment of 802 students. While the school has a relatively low student-teacher ratio, it lags behind state averages in academic performance, with below-average proficiency rates in English Language Arts and Mathematics across all grades.

Bonner Springs High School is ranked 268 out of 332 Kansas high schools for the 2024-2025 school year and is rated 1 out of 5 stars by SchoolDigger. The school's 4-year graduation rate of 89.5% is slightly below the state average, and its dropout rate of 1.3% is lower than the state average. However, the school's chronic absenteeism rate of 19.5% is higher than the state average, which may be impacting student learning and achievement.

The school serves a relatively high proportion of economically disadvantaged students, with 48.63% of students receiving free or reduced-price lunch. This factor may contribute to the school's lower academic performance, though further investigation would be needed to identify the specific challenges faced by the student population and explore strategies to improve student outcomes. Despite the school's lower rankings, it maintains a student-teacher ratio that is lower than the state average, which could be a positive factor in supporting student learning.
